2015-04-08 18 views
5

Tôi cần gỡ lỗi ứng dụng web trong Firefox cho "Android". Tôi đang cố gắng kết nối thiết bị với máy tính để bàn Firefox, nhưng luôn luôn có lỗi "lỗi không mong muốn".Gỡ lỗi từ xa của Firefox "lỗi không mong muốn" trên Windows 8

tôi đã thực hiện tất cả các bước của https://developer.mozilla.org/en-US/docs/Tools/Remote_Debugging/Firefox_for_Android

  1. Tôi đã cài đặt các công cụ SDK Android và nền tảng, và các thiết bị được phát hiện một cách chính xác với lệnh adb.

  2. tôi kích hoạt gỡ lỗi từ xa trên desktop Firefox và Firefox dành cho Android

  3. tôi kích hoạt từ xa USB gỡ lỗi trên thiết bị.

  4. Thiết bị được kết nối với cáp ban đầu vào máy tính của tôi.

  5. Tôi chạy lệnh adb chuyển tiếp tcp: 6000 tcp: 6000 trên dòng lệnh mà không gặp sự cố.

  6. Cuối cùng, trình đơn Firefox dành cho nhà phát triển trên máy tính để bàn, tôi chọn tùy chọn kết nối. Trang xuất hiện để kết nối với localhost: 6000 và nhấp vào nút "kết nối", lỗi "lỗi không mong muốn" xuất hiện.

Bất kỳ ý tưởng nào?

Trả lời

7

Tìm thấy giải pháp!

Thay vì nhập:

adb forward tcp:6000 tcp:6000 

gõ như sau:

adb forward tcp:6000 localfilesystem:/data/data/org.mozilla.firefox/firefox-debugger-socket 

Lệnh đầu tiên dành cho firefox 34, cho các phiên bản sau, bạn cần thứ hai.

Ngoài ra, theo các tài liệu:

Đối với Firefox dành cho Android được xây dựng trong các kênh truyền hình khác, phần org.mozilla.firefox nên được thay đổi:

  • org.mozilla.firefox_beta cho Beta
  • org.mozilla.fennec_aurora cho Aurora
  • org.mozilla.fennec cho hàng đêm
+0

Không có giải pháp nào bạn đã cung cấp. Bất kỳ lý do nào khác có thể là ?? – bShah

+0

Cổng 6000 của bạn có bị bỏ trống không? –

Các vấn đề liên quan